For the first time I saw pictures of ancient New Testament Greek documents.
It didn't look like my UBS3 at all.

I was then informed that first century Greek did not have punctuations or
accents.

Is this correct?

Is so, when did punctuations and accents first appear?

Also, did earlier Greek (Hellenistic and Homeric, etc) have punctuations and
accents?
